Another lesson from testing the merge into the trunk: the ChangeLog
file will be a mess (since both the trunk and the branch have changes
adjacent to each other, most of the revisions conflict with the
previous revision). We might want to consider generating the ChangeLog
file from the SVN revision messages.

Considering the latter, I'm all for it. Most of the time, the SVN revision message is duplicated from the ChangeLog anyway (at least, that's what I do). We might just as well automate this, so we only need to fill in the SVN revision message.

And with something like this, we might even be able to match the current ChangeLog format:

http://arthurdejong.org/svn2cl/

I think I've seen one or two more variants of this - I will dig them up if that's what we want to do.
